In the wake of the global pandemic, a new challenge has emerged – long Covid, a perplexing condition that continues to stump healthcare professionals and patients alike. With lingering symptoms and a myriad of physical and mental challenges, long Covid has led many to search for alternative treatment approaches.
Long Covid can present with a wide array of symptoms, from debilitating fatigue and brain fog to joint pain and difficulty breathing. And these symptoms exist on a spectrum of severity – they can be relatively mild or they can be all-encompassing, making it impossible to live your life. The mental challenges are just as profound, as patients grapple with anxiety, depression, and a sense of isolation in their search for answers and relief.
